Onaruto Bridge Floating Promenade Uzu-no-Michi
[,Nature & Scenery,Others]
Uzu-no-michi is the promenade(walkway)under the Onaruto Bridge.You can look down at the roaring whirlpools through the glass floor which is directly 45m above the sea. -

Janes Residence
[Famous/Historical Spots,Others]
This residence was built in 1871 to welcome American military veteran and educator Leroy Lansing Janes on his arrival in Kumamoto to head the Kumamoto Yogakko School. -
